1. Install a job pack

~2 min

A job pack is a ready-made kit for one ops job — a few MCP tools and a scoped key.

What you do

  1. Open Get started (or Alerts) in your workspace
  2. Pick Ship Guard, Stripe Ops, Status Room, On-call, or Web3 Watch
  3. Confirm the pack — Herald creates tools + a scoped key
What you should see. You see the pack tools listed and a key that can only call those tools (plus inbox if the pack allows it).
